Annual Short Term Debt:
$1.65B-$32.80M(-1.95%)Summary
- As of today, GPN annual short term debt is $1.65 billion, with the most recent change of -$32.80 million (-1.95%) on December 31, 2024.
- During the last 3 years, GPN annual short term debt has risen by +$984.46 million (+147.76%).
- GPN annual short term debt is now -17.33% below its all-time high of $2.00 billion, reached on December 31, 2022.

Quarterly Short Term Debt:
$2.88B+$380.44M(+15.24%)Summary
- As of today, GPN quarterly short term debt is $2.88 billion, with the most recent change of +$380.44 million (+15.24%) on September 30, 2025.
- Over the past year, GPN quarterly short term debt has increased by +$535.72 million (+22.89%).
- GPN quarterly short term debt is now at all-time high.

Short Term Debt Formula
Short-Term Debt = Current Portion of Long-Term Debt + Short-Term Loans + Commercial Paper + Other Short-Term Borrowings
